X-Git-Url: https://git.rapsys.eu/airbundle/blobdiff_plain/c2c98c325c080c171b752a605ce8cf7dd9f2ed26..067bc23c217329ce65497f5b4defd9109e71edeb:/Entity/Application.php diff --git a/Entity/Application.php b/Entity/Application.php index b54b1e2..5d31203 100644 --- a/Entity/Application.php +++ b/Entity/Application.php @@ -22,6 +22,11 @@ class Application { */ private $id; + /** + * @var Dance + */ + private $dance; + /** * @var float */ @@ -56,6 +61,11 @@ class Application { * Constructor */ public function __construct() { + //Set defaults + $this->score = null; + $this->canceled = null; + $this->created = new \DateTime('now'); + $this->updated = new \DateTime('now'); $this->session = null; $this->user = null; } @@ -69,6 +79,28 @@ class Application { return $this->id; } + /** + * Set dance + * + * @param Dance $dance + * + * @return Application + */ + public function setDance(Dance $dance): Application { + $this->dance = $dance; + + return $this; + } + + /** + * Get dance + * + * @return Dance + */ + public function getDance(): Dance { + return $this->dance; + } + /** * Set score * @@ -206,9 +238,9 @@ class Application { */ public function preUpdate(PreUpdateEventArgs $eventArgs) { //Check that we have an application instance - if (($user = $eventArgs->getEntity()) instanceof Application) { + if (($application = $eventArgs->getEntity()) instanceof Application) { //Set updated value - $user->setUpdated(new \DateTime('now')); + $application->setUpdated(new \DateTime('now')); } } }